PORTLAND, Oregon — With five medals coming in the span of five minutes, Team USA won a total of eight medals Saturday night at the IAAF World Indoor Championships, including an American record by Michelle Carter. With one day of competition remaining at the Oregon Convention Center, Team USA has 15 medals, including eight gold in 17 events contested thus far. Germany, Ukraine and Great Britain each have three medals, with nine other countries each having one gold. Team USA leads the placing table with 159 points; Great Britain is second with 29.
